Role Purpose

Oversee a blended model of in-house direct labour teams and external supply chain partners, lead and empower your teams to successfully deliver effective building, mechanical, electrical and regulated compliance related works and services across the organisation's property portfolio to ensure our homes are safe and well maintained. Delivering against challenging KPI's, ensure continuous improvement and customer safety across gas, fire, water, electrical, lifts, M&E and asbestos.

Working with the Property Services Director and Assistant Directors to shape and implement the Property Compliance Delivery strategies to deliver effective building/property regulatory compliance in line with statutory, regulatory and policy requirements. Instrumental in leading change and embedding a positive, enthusiastic, and empowered culture that enables colleagues to deliver good performance and great customer service.

Lead on new ways of working including the use of modern digital solutions to make our business more effective, agile, and responsive, requiring a forward and outward looking approach as well as an open mind and applying Lean principles in decision making.

Key Accountabilities

  • Shape and contribute to the organisation's long-term compliance strategy, ensuring alignment with national housing policy and emerging legislation.
  • Lead on the effective management of statutory compliance, ensuring all regulatory and legislative responsibilities for gas, electrical, asbestos, fire safety, legionella, water, and lifts are delivered.
  • Oversee the delivery of regulatory repairs within the required timelines such as Damp, Mould and Condensation, Disrepair cases, and HHSRS related complex repairs, oversee escalated complaints that require additional attention to de-escalate and resolve.
  • Responsibility for preparing and presenting detailed assurance, risk and performance reports to the senior leadership teams and relevant committees / boards.
  • Ensure services delivered have customers at the heart of decision making, proving excellent customer service which prioritises keeping them safe.
  • Accountable for performance targets, budgets and work programmes, agreeing and monitoring these and ensuring team managers align and set objectives that deliver the strategic and directorate plan.
  • Manage critical relationships with stakeholders both internally and externally including but not limited to, in-house colleagues and external contractors, senior stakeholders, governing bodies, external auditors and consultants and legal representatives.
  • Lead a team which is capable of delivering all current and new regulated delivery, such as Awaab's Law, HHSRS, and disrepair cases.
  • Lead on external audits, inspections and regulatory reviews.
  • Ensure effective property compliance 1st line assurance is in place for all areas of service and works delivery.
  • Lead on the development of the compliance schedule, creating programmes on a pre-emptive cycle to ensure that the business remains compliant.
  • Recruit, manage, coach, motivate, and develop colleagues within your team in line with organisational policies.
  • Critically evaluate compliance information and KPIs, producing regular assurance reports covering all areas of compliance performance, processes, procedures, and statutory responsibilities.
  • Oversee the development and on-going review of compliance related policies and procedures, in line with legislation and industry best practice.
  • Ensure a sustainable suite of competent specialist Supply Chain partners is in place.
  • Ensure that business compliance responsibilities are complied with in respect of properties where there is no maintenance responsibility.
